The 7th Congressional District of Illinois includes part of Cook County. It covers downtown Chicago as well as some of the west and south sides of city and some west suburban areas in Cook County. It has been represented by Democrat Danny K. Davis since 1997. Abraham Lincoln represented the 7th district before being elected President.

John McCain received 12% of the vote in this district in 2008. The district has a Cook Partisan Voting Index score of D +35.
